vIST/e description
|
Interactive visualization of imaging data
Created as an useful and complex software, vIST/e is a tool that offers interactive visualization of various kinds of imaging datasets.
This C++ application allows you to view both simple scalar data as well as complex high-dimensional data (such as diffusion tensor imaging (DTI) and high angular resolution imaging data (HARDI)).
vIST/e is a tool that's based on VTK, Qt and is developed as a plugin system which allows it to be extended in a flexible way.
Here are some key features of "vIST/e":
· vIST/e is programmed in C++. It uses Kitware's Visualization Toolkit for visualization and pipelined data processing, as well as Nokia's Qt for an easy-to-use Graphical User Interface.
· vIST/e introduces a powerful new plugin system, which allows for modular development with increased extensibility and stability.
· Powerful GPU-based visualization techniques allow for smooth, real-time visualization of large data sets. Using custom ray tracing algorithms created with OpenGL, vIST/e can render DTI ellipsoids and HARDI spherical harmonics glyphs up to 4th order. The high frame rates offered by modern GPU technology allows for interactive exploration of this complex data.
· Diffusion Tensor Imaging data can be visualized and interactively explored in a number of ways, including multiple cross-sections, volume rendering, and tensor glyphs. Derived scalar volumes, including various different anisotropy measures, can be computed and visualized. Data from other modalities, such as structural MRI, can be shown alongside the DTI data.
· Various fiber tracking methods allow for fast and accurate reconstruction of fiber pathways. Interactively defined Regions of Interest (ROIs) can be used for seeding and filtering of fibers. Fibers are visualized either as lines, optionally using a powerful, GPU-based lighting engine, or as 3D structures such as tubes.
· Scalar volumes, glyphs, and fibers can be colored using a wide array of coloring option. Customizable color loop-up tables allow for highly flexible visualization of scalar data.
· Visualization and processing of various different HARDI formats is supported. HARDI data is interactively visualized using highly detailed glyphs rendered on the GPU. HARDI glyphs can be visualized in combination with DTI glyphs, for a better overview of complex diffusion data.
· vIST/e includes support for NVIDIA's Compute Unified Device Architecture (CUDA), which enables highly parallel, GPU-based data processing, allowing for significant speed-up of computationally expensive algorithms.
What's New in This Release: [ read full changelog ]
· HARDI Fiber Tracking Plugin (tested with .sharm and .nii data)
· Saving Scalar and DTI volumes in Nifti format.
· Saving and Reading Scalar and DTI volumes in .vti format.
· Saving Discrete Sphere, Spherical Harmonics data in Nifti MIND format.
· Crop3D Plugin: 3D Croping Scalar and DTI data
· Reading nii.gz file format
· Some compiling problems were also solved
